The beverage industry is undergoing some significant shifts, and Coca-Cola is right in the thick of it. With growing health consciousness among consumers, there’s been a noticeable decline in the demand for sugary drinks. People are increasingly opting for healthier alternatives, including water, teas, and low or zero-calorie beverages. As a result, Coca-Cola has been investing in diversification, broadening its product range to include healthier options, sparkling waters, and functional beverages to meet evolving consumer preferences. The introduction of drinks with natural ingredients and enticing flavors is becoming more critical to capture a market that is leaning away from classic sugary sodas. This transformative approach not only retains their existing customer base but also attracts a new clientele eager for more health-oriented substances in their drinks.

Response to Sustainability Challenges
Environmental sustainability is a pressing issue today, and many companies, including Coca-Cola, are now facing the heat over their packaging practices. In recent years, Coca-Cola has set ambitious goals for reducing plastic waste and improving recycling efforts. The company has publicly committed to making its packaging recyclable or reusable by a certain year and aims for a significant reduction in carbon emissions. Taking such measures not only helps the environment but also strengthens their reputation among consumers who prioritize sustainability. By investing in biodegradable materials and exploring refillable packaging, Coca-Cola is positioning itself as a leader in the environmental stewardship movement within the beverage industry, seeking to balance operational success with ecological responsibility.

Adapting to Regulatory Pressures
As the global regulatory landscape around health and wellness continues to tighten, Coca-Cola faces additional challenges that require astute navigation. From sugar taxes to stricter advertising guidelines, the beverage giant must adapt to keep its products in line with governmental standards and address health concerns. The company has taken proactive steps to reformulate its products in response to such regulations, aiming for lower sugar options or even entirely sugar-free alternatives. Transparency in labeling and marketing practices is another area where Coca-Cola is working diligently to maintain compliance and foster trust with consumers. By addressing these matters head-on, Coca-Cola can not only maintain its market share but potentially capitalize on its competitors’ struggles with regulatory compliance.
